Building Up Jax: Old Navy heading to Durbin Park; Lucky’s Market shutting down

OLD NAVY ANNOUNCED FOR DURBIN PARK

Another junior anchor tenant has been announced at The Pavilion at Durbin Park.

Clothing retailer Old Navy will be added to the development as its final junior anchor tenant, joining Burlington, ROSS, Five Below, Dollar Tree, and Petco.

Around 40,000 sq. ft. of retail and restaurant space remains to be leased; the Old Navy spot, however, was by far the largest remaining vacancy.

In addition, Peterbrooke Chocolatier is now open within the shopping center.

LUCKY’S MARKET TO CLOSE ITS LOCATIONS

Lucky’s Market will close both of its Jax-area locations as it plans to shutter all but seven of its stores.

The grocer had locations in Neptune Beach and near Oakleaf Town Center.

FIVE POINTS PLAZA SOLD IN FERNANDINA

Five Points Plaza at 8th St. and Sadler Rd. in Fernandina Beach was recently sold for $5.4 million.

The 31,800-sq.-ft. shopping center is anchored by Dollar Tree and also added Beach Diner as a tenant within the past few years.

The sale was facilitated by Matt Entriken and Robert W. Selton of Colliers International Northeast Florida, who represented the seller (T.J. of Nassau, Inc.), and Skinner Bros. Realty Company who represented the buyer (not disclosed).

WAWA UPDATES

Wawa at Philips Hwy. and Bowden Rd. is now open, and the gas station brand also submitted plans this week for a future station at University Blvd. and Commerce St.

NOTED PROJECTS

  • Mr. Snappers Fish & Chicken will open soon at 1338 Dunn Ave.
  • JAX ILF 1, LLC received a permit for construction of a $19 million independent living facility at 4060 San Pablo Pkwy.
  • KB Home submitted plans for Hudson Grove, a 95-home single-family development along New Berlin Rd. near Dunn Creek Rd.
  • The Joint Chiropractic received a permit for build-out at 10991 San Jose Blvd.
